How they compare
Vanuatu currently reports 58.1% against 57.8% in Botswana,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 26 shared years of data; in 1996 it was Botswana ahead.
Botswana ranks 74th and Vanuatu ranks 72nd of 208 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Botswana averaged higher in 3 and Vanuatu in 1.
